Ice Cream Sundaes with Chocolate-Coffee Sauce

5.0

(1)

Kate makes the chocolate sauce with homemade liqueur.

Recipe information

  • Yield

    Makes 10 servings

Ingredients

6 ounces bittersweet chocolate, chopped
1/2 cup plus 2 tablespoons Homemade Coffee-Flavored Liqueur or Kahlúa plus additional for passing
1/4 cup heavy whipping cream
1/2 gallon purchased vanilla ice cream

Preparation

  1. Step 1

    Combine chocolate, liqueur, and whipping cream in heavy small saucepan. Whisk over medium heat until melted and smooth.

    Step 2

    Scoop ice cream into dessert dishes or goblets. Spoon warm sauce over. Serve, passing additional liqueur.
